Across TCGA cell cohorts, POLI RNA expression is significantly associated with the go_rna of many other GO terms, with 3,594 significant associations in total. LUNG_SCLC shows the largest number of these associations.

The most reproducible POLI-associated GO terms across cancer lineages are Peptidyl-lysine acetylation, Protein localization to cytoplasmic stress granule, and Non-motile cilium assembly. Each is linked with POLI in more than 11 cancer types. Because this analysis shows association rather than direction, both POLI-to-partner and partner-to-POLI results are reported.
